What Is Workers Compensation Insurance?

Simply put, workers compensation insurance is insurance against the risk of your employees getting injured on the job.

Let’s say that you run a general contracting company.

While an employee is repairing a deck for one of your many customers, he or she falls off and breaks his or her leg. The medical bills that result are significant.

The worker is unable to do their work for a significant amount of time. Thus, they need compensation for lost wages.

They may need to hire a workers’ compensation lawyer to receive damages.

However, if you have the right insurance program in place, this workers compensation lawyer will work with the insurance company to ensure that the employee gets what they need as compensation at a minimal out-of-pocket expense to your business.

In these situations, you ought to retain legal counsel as well to ensure that your company is doing everything in the proper manner.

Is Workers Compensation Insurance Mandatory?

Workers comp laws vary from state to state.

As a result, only you can determine whether or not workmans compensation is a government-ordained requirement for your company. Check with your region’s labor laws to see if you need to pay this premium.

However, even if workers compensation insurance isn’t mandatory in your state, it’s still an excellent idea to carry this insurance regardless.

Even the smallest medical injury can result in significant medical bills.

And when you add in lost wages to the mix, that’s a very significant cost that you would otherwise be liable to pay for out of pocket.
